PRACTICE AREAS
- Conducted over 100 trials. Recent trials: 3 day contested Guardianship; 12 day bench trial defending claims for breach of a non-compete and trade secrets; 6 day jury trial in federal court defending a boat manufacturer against claims for breach of warranty and fraud
- Estate Trust Litigation including defense of claims by dissatisfied relatives and former business partners - One recent estate required the filing or disposition of 37 separate lawsuits.
- Business Litigation including contract disputes, trade secrets, warranty claims, copyright and trademark protection
- Construction Litigation including architect`s liability, contractual indemnity, insurance coverage, public bidding issues, performance and payment bonds
- Real Estate Litigation including environmental and brownfield issues, underground storage tanks, realtor error and omission defense, and easements
- Experience in representing lenders in recovering losses from mortgage fraud.
